Jaipur: Comedian Shyam Rangeela, who became famous for his mimicry of PM Narendra Modi, has joined the Aam Aadmi Party (AAP). He joined the party on Thursday in the presence of Rajasthan AAP in-charge Vinay Mishra. Shyam Rangeela heaped praise on the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) and Arvind Kejriwal on the occasion.

"I have never seen any such party or leader except AAP who says that if you don't like my work, don't vote for me next time. I was impressed with him and I am joining the party because of this. Shyam Rangeela has said that he has not yet been given any responsibility by the party as he had urged him to work independently. At the same time, AAP has also informed about Shyam Rangeela joining the party.

AAP tweeted, "The famous comedian of Rajasthan Shyam Rangeela has joined the Aam Aadmi Party. Shyam Rangeela has been bringing a smile to the sad faces of people through his comedy. Now, through his art, he will tell and make people aware of the health and education revolution on behalf of the Aam Aadmi Party. Aam Aadmi Party is doing politics of work in the country. "
